Ville-Marie is the oldest community in Abitibi-Témiscamingue. This toponym honours the protection of the congregation of the Oblates of Mary Immaculate and underlines the determining role of this religious community in the colonization of the Temiscamingue region. A visit to the site of the Maison du Frère Moffet allows us to revisit this part of our history. At the east end of Notre-Dame-de-Lourdes Street, you will find a grotto similar to the one of the same name in France. Every year, hundreds of pilgrims gather there. A belvedere offers a superb view of the city and the lake, and there are paths available.
